SSID: The SSID of the Smart Repeater Pro will be displayed
here.
Authentication Mode: The wireless security authentication mode
of the Smart Repeater will be displayed here. If you do not
enable the security function of the Smart Repeater Pro before
WPS is activated, the Smart Repeater Pro will automatically set
the security to WPA (AES) and generate a set passphrase key for
a WPS connection.
Passphrase Key: The wireless security key of the Smart
Repeater Pro will be displayed here.
There are "Registrar" and "Enrollee" modes for the WPS
connection. When "Registrar" is enabled, the wireless clients
will follow the Smart Repeater Pro's wireless settings for WPS
connection. When "Enrolle" mode is enabled, the Smart
Repeater Pro will follow the wireless settings of wireless client
for WPS connection.
Click "Start PBC" to start Push-Button style WPS
setup procedure. The Smart Repeater Pro will wait for WPS
requests from wireless clients for 2 minutes. The "Wireless"
LED on the Smart Repeater Pro will be on steadily for 2 minutes
while the Smart Repeater Pro waits for incoming WPS requests.
Please input the PIN code of the wireless client you
wish to connect, and click "Start PIN" button.
The "WLAN" LED on the wireless Smart Repeater Pro will be
steady on when this wireless Smart Repeater Pro is waiting for
incoming WPS request.
